Kidding aside, Gr\u00fcner Veltliner is named for its color and hometown. The word Gr\u00fcner means green in English, and Veltliner is its village of origin. Genetic analysis shows that it&#8217;s the offspring of Savagnin and an obscure Austrian grapevine named St. Georgener-Rebe that produces no grapes.<\/p>\n<p>Today Gr\u00fcner Veltliner is prized as Austria&#8217;s &#8220;Very Own&#8221; and most widely planted grape. While it dates back to the mid-1800s, its resident adoration didn&#8217;t start until the mid-1900s when it became the favorite wine served in wine-gardens, known as Heurigen&#8217;s and Buschenschank&#8217;s. Here vineyard keepers serve fresh glasses of the current vintage in a warm and cozy atmosphere. For #Winetravelers, then and now, Heurigen&#8217;s and Buschenschank&#8217;s are places to socialize, relax, and, most importantly, sample authentic Austrian wine and food.<\/p>\n<p>Later in the early 2000s, Gr\u00fcner Veltliner went from being a local wine bottled in liter format with a crown cap to gaining international attention as a contender rivaling <span style=\"color: #ff9900;\"><a style=\"color: #ff9900;\" href=\"https:\/\/www.winetraveler.com\/grape\/chardonnay-wine-grape-characteristics\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><strong>Chardonnay<\/strong><\/a><\/span>. How? Because of Gr\u00fcner Veltliner&#8217;s supernatural ability to match with virtually any food, including the bitterly uncooperative artichoke and asparagus. Gr\u00fcner&#8217;s friendly disposition landed it in a prestigious blind-tasting conducted by world-renowned wine experts. Pitted against Chardonnay, &#8220;GruVe&#8221; swept 7 out of 10 categories proving its ability to produce fine, full-bodied wines capable of aging.<\/p>\n<h2>Terroir and Gr\u00fcner Veltliner Growing Regions<\/h2>\n<p>To express its full potential, GV needs to be planted on mineral-rich slopes composed of silt, sand, clay, and rock with sunny exposure and cool evening breezes. While Austria&#8217;s finest expressions come from vineyards above the <strong>Danube River, in Wachau, Kremstal, and Kamptal regions, <\/strong>it&#8217;s also cultivated in neighboring<strong> Trentino-Alto Adige Valle Isarco, Italy, the Czech Republic, Slovakia,<\/strong> and <strong>Hungary<\/strong>. But since quality Gr\u00fcner Veltliner has begun to make a global impact, vines have been planted in <strong>Portugal, Adelaide Hills,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.winetraveler.com\/tag\/australia\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Australia<\/a>, Central Otago,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.winetraveler.com\/new-zealand\/best-new-zealand-wine-regions\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">New Zealand<\/a>, Clarksburg, San Benito,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.winetraveler.com\/california\/santa-barbara-itinerary-wine-tasting-trip\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Santa Barbara<\/a>, Santa Cruz,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.winetraveler.com\/oregon\/willamette-valley-itinerary\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Willamette Valley<\/a>, Edna Valley, Umpqua Valley, Columbia Gorge<\/strong> and<strong> Washington<\/strong>.<\/p>\n<h2>Gr\u00fcner Veltliner Tasting Notes<\/h2>\n<p>Gr\u00fcner Veltliner is typically vinified as a single variety, and it is made into an incredible spectrum of styles and structures, from long-aging, richly dense, fruited wines to high-toned, electric, racy, sparkling, sweet and eiswein. Its color is pale straw with hints of green and can have a slight effervescence in youth, giving rise to vivid aromatics of grapefruit, lime, lemon, white flowers, gunpowder, dill, and wasabi. In terms of taste, expect searing acidity followed by yellow apple, tropical fruit, radish, arugula, watercress, tarragon, sage, ginger, honey, and saffron.<\/p>\n<h2>Food Pairing Gr\u00fcner Veltliner Wines<\/h2>\n<p>As mentioned, GV has the capacity to complement practically any food.
